网页制作的艺术与科学
在数字化时代,网页制作不再是一项简单的任务,而是一种艺术与科学的结合。随着技术的不断进步,网页制作已经成为了一种强大的工具,可以用来创建网站、在线应用程序和多媒体内容。本文将探讨网页制作的基本概念、技巧以及其在现代互联网中的应用。
网页设计的基础原则
目标明确
在进行网页设计之前,首先需要明确设计的目的。是为了吸引访问者?还是为了销售产品?或者是为了提供信息服务?目标明确有助于设计师确定合适的设计方向和布局。
视觉层次
视觉层次是通过设计元素的安排,引导用户注意力并传达信息的重要性。使用大小、颜色、对比度和位置等手段,可以突出关键信息,使用户能够快速抓住重点。
网页制作的工具和技术
HTML和CSS
HTML(超文本标记语言)和CSS(层叠样式表)是网页制作的基础技术。HTML负责定义网页的结构和内容,而CSS则负责美化网页的布局和样式。通过结合这两种技术,可以创建出结构清晰、美观大方的网页。
响应式设计
响应式设计是一种使网页在不同设备和屏幕尺寸上都能良好显示的技术。通过使用媒体查询、流式布局和弹性图片等方法,可以确保网页在手机、平板和桌面设备上都能提供良好的用户体验。
网页优化的技巧
页面加载速度
页面加载速度是影响用户体验的重要因素之一。通过优化图片大小、压缩CSS和JavaScript文件、使用CDN等方法,可以显著提高网页的加载速度,减少用户的等待时间。
可访问性
可访问性是指网页对所有用户,包括残障人士的可用性和可理解性。通过遵循WCAG(Web Content Accessibility Guidelines)等国际标准,可以确保网页内容对所有人都是可访问的。
网页制作的未来趋势
交互式内容
随着人工智能和机器学习技术的发展,未来的网页将更加注重交互式内容的创建。通过使用虚拟现实(VR)、增强现实(AR)和自然语言处理等技术,可以为用户提供更加沉浸式和个性化的体验。
无服务器架构
无服务器架构是一种将应用程序代码部署在云服务上,而不是传统的服务器上的方法。通过使用AWS Lambda、Google Cloud Functions等技术,可以实现高效的网页应用开发和部署,降低运维成本。
结语
网页制作是一项既需要创意又需要技术的任务。通过掌握网页设计的基础原则、熟练使用各种工具和技术、优化网页性能以及关注未来的发展趋势,可以创建出既美观又实用的网页,为用户提供优质的互联网体验。随着技术的不断进步,网页制作将继续发展,带来更多创新的可能性。
网页设计中的色彩运用
色彩心理学
色彩在网页设计中扮演着重要的角色。不同的颜色能够引发人们不同的情感和联想。例如,红色通常被视为激情和紧急的象征,而蓝色则给人以稳定和信任的感觉。设计师可以通过色彩心理学来选择合适的颜色组合,以传达特定的信息和情感。
色彩搭配
色彩搭配是网页设计中的另一个关键要素。良好的色彩搭配能够使网页看起来更加和谐、统一。设计师可以使用色轮来选择和谐的颜色组合,或者利用对比色来突出关键元素。此外,色彩的饱和度和明度也会影响网页的整体效果,因此需要根据设计需求进行合理搭配。
色彩趋势
随着设计行业的不断发展,色彩趋势也在不断变化。设计师需要关注当前的色彩趋势,并将其融入到自己的设计中。例如,近年来流行的色彩包括温暖的色调、冷色调以及渐变色等。通过运用这些色彩趋势,可以使网页设计更加时尚、现代。
网页设计中的排版技巧
字体选择
字体是网页设计中的基本元素之一。选择合适的字体对于提升网页的可读性和美观性至关重要。设计师应该根据网页的内容和风格选择适合的字体。例如,用于正文排版的字体应该清晰易读,而用于标题排版的字体则应该具有较高的视觉冲击力。
行高和字间距
行高和字间距是影响网页可读性的重要因素。合适的行高可以使文本更加易读,而合适的字间距则可以避免文本过于拥挤或过于稀疏。设计师需要根据文本的用途和长度来调整行高和字间距,以确保用户能够舒适地阅读网页内容。
文本对齐
文本对齐是网页设计中的基本排版技巧之一。通过使用左对齐、右对齐、居中对齐或两端对齐等方式,可以使文本更加整齐、易读。设计师需要根据网页的设计风格和内容选择合适的文本对齐方式。
网页设计中的图像运用
图像选择
图像是网页设计中的重要元素之一。选择合适的图像可以提高网页的吸引力和用户体验。设计师应该根据网页的内容和风格选择适合的图像。例如,用于背景的图像应该具有较高的清晰度和质量,而用于图标和按钮的图像则应该简洁明了。
图像优化
图像优化是提高网页加载速度的重要手段。通过压缩图像、调整图像尺寸和格式等方式,可以显著减小图像文件的大小,从而提高网页的加载速度。设计师需要根据网页的需求和用户的设备来选择合适的图像优化策略。
图像布局
图像布局是网页设计中的另一个关键要素。通过合理的图像布局,可以使网页看起来更加美观、有序。设计师可以使用图像排列、图像组合和图像蒙版等技术来实现各种图像布局效果。同时,需要注意图像之间的层次感和空间感,以确保用户能够清晰地看到每个图像的内容。
网页设计中的交互元素
鼠标悬停效果
鼠标悬停效果是一种常见的网页交互元素。通过为按钮或链接添加鼠标悬停效果,可以增强用户的交互体验。例如,当用户将鼠标悬停在按钮上时,可以改变按钮的背景颜色或文字颜色,以提供视觉反馈。
交互式表单
交互式表单是网页设计中常见的功能之一。通过使用表单验证、动态填充和实时反馈等技术,可以提高表单的用户体验。设计师需要根据表单的需求和用户的输入方式来设计合适的交互式表单。
动画效果
动画效果可以为网页增添动感和趣味性。通过使用CSS动画、JavaScript和HTML5等技术,可以实现各种动画效果。设计师需要注意动画的效果和时长,以避免过度干扰用户的浏览体验。
网页设计中的响应式设计
媒体查询
媒体查询是实现响应式设计的关键技术之一。通过使用媒体查询,可以根据不同的设备和屏幕尺寸来应用不同的样式规则。例如,可以为移动设备设置较小的字体大小和窄屏幕布局,而为桌面设备设置较大的字体大小和全屏布局。
流式布局
流式布局是一种使网页在不同设备和屏幕尺寸上都能良好显示的布局方式。通过使用百分比宽度、相对单位(如em和rem)和弹性图片等技术,可以实现流式布局。这种布局方式可以确保网页内容在不同设备上都能自适应地调整大小和位置。
弹性图片
弹性图片是指能够根据设备的屏幕尺寸自动调整大小的图片。通过使用max-width和height属性,可以使图片在容器内自适应地调整大小。这种图片布局方式可以提高网页的加载速度和响应性,同时避免图片的过宽或过窄。
结语
网页设计是一项综合性的工作,涉及到色彩、排版、图像、交互元素和响应式设计等多个方面。通过掌握这些设计原则和技巧,可以创建出既美观又实用的网页,为用户提供优质的互联网体验。随着技术的不断进步,网页设计将继续发展,带来更多创新的可能性。